What is the difference between eggshell and satin paint?
Eggshell and satin sit between matt and gloss, with a low-to-moderate sheen that reflects a small amount of light — this gives a slight depth to the colour without the strong reflections of gloss, and is generally more wipeable than matt.

Practical advice
A common mid-point choice for woodwork, trim or walls in rooms that need to be cleaned regularly, such as kitchens and hallways, without going as reflective as gloss.
Always confirm with a physical sample in the actual finish before committing to a large surface — see methodology.
